Faceless Name

Crouched over in the shower

Last night's mascara dripping down the drain

As well as her innocence being washed away

Feeling she is the only one to blame


Blurs of what happened 

Haunted her mind

Trying to block images

Wishing to God she was now blind


REWIND... trying to fit in

at a party he took her to the side

Anxious butterflies filling her stomach

Oh how he lied

 

NO! she swore she yelled

It a thousand times

or was it her mind being deceitful

Maybe it was whispers she couldn't decide


He told her to grow up

Stop crying now

Biting her lip

blood trickled down


Her first time was robbed

Of the way she dreamt it would be

There was such damage

Such irreversibility


Each time he touched Her skin

having his way

She felt it was on fire 

Her mind went far away


Back in the shower

She felt powerless and Shame

Her wounds no longer showed

a lifetime scar, she was a faceless name
